Notice of "Soccer Class in Ushiku" for children aged 4 to 12 (March 27)

We will hold a football clinic at Ushiku Sports Park Multi-Purpose Plaza on Sunday, March 27.

Anyone can participate, regardless of whether they are a school student or have football experience. Please invite your friends and join us!

[About COVID-19 Countermeasures Guidelines]
Please be sure to take your temperature on the day of participation.
On the day of participation, adults (18 years or older) with a fever of 37.0°C or higher, and minors (under 18 years old) with a fever of 37.5°C or higher, cannot participate. Also, if you experience difficulty breathing, fatigue, malaise, or abnormalities in taste or smell, you cannot participate.

If the participant or a cohabitant has experienced any of the above health problems within one week prior to the day of participation, they cannot participate.
Those who have been requested to refrain from going out by their educational institution (such as a school) or workplace cannot participate.

Please strictly observe the following points when participating:

1) Be able to disclose your activity record for the past two weeks (when, where, and what you were doing) to the club.
2) Participants understand the risks and have confirmed infection prevention measures.
3) Always wear a mask when attending the venue.
4) Maintain social distance and avoid crowded situations. If instructed by the management, please follow their instructions.
5) If you feel unwell during participation, report it immediately and return home.
6) Prepare your own bottle/water bottle at home and do not use others' (be sure to write your name clearly to prevent mix-ups).
7) Even on the pitch, observe cough etiquette, do not spit or blow your nose.
8) After the event, promptly withdraw and return home.
